'The New London Bridge as it appeared on Monday August 1st, 1831, at the Ceremony of Opening by their Majesties'.
Published by Whittaker & Co, London.
The engraving shows balloon possibly piloted by British balloonist Charles Green ascending over New London Bridge on the occasion of its opening, August 1, 1831, witnessed by William IV and Queen Adelaide.
John Rennie was the architect of the bridge.
